So these both mean better, but they have differences.

Mas bien tarde que nunca.

Mejor tarde que nunca.

Better late than never.

But "Mas bien" is also like "better yet" or "better suited".

Estos vídeos son mejores para hombres Heidita says this one is a no go.

but

estos videos son más bien para hombres. works perfect.

So I think mas bien is like "better suited" or "better yet" and the reason it doesn't work with mejor "Estos vídeos son mejores para hombres" is because .... well why exactly?

Gracias.

Also is it Más bien or Mas bien?

Más bien.

The meaning of both overlap, but there are some differences.

In the example you gave about the videos, "más bien" has another meaning: rather. These videos are rather for men. Similar but different from "better".

In fact, I think you should do well enough if you take más bien to mean "rather", all the time. I'm testing it in my head, and I believe it works.
